1.用例覆盖范围的全面性
用户验收用例应确保覆盖业务需求涉及的所有功能点,包括正常业务流程校验、异常业务流程校验、各种功能合法性校验、功能逻辑的校验等。
2.用例设计方法的专业性
恰当的使用用户验收用例设计方法,包括:等价类划分法、边界值分析法、错误推测法等。通过专业的设计方法保证用例能够覆盖各种合理的和不合理、合法的和非法的、边界的和越界的、以及极限的输入数据、业务操作等。
3.用例编写的规范性
按照规范准确描述用户验收用例的预置条件、操作步骤、预期结果等关键信息。一个用例的多个步骤要重点突出,清晰明了的说明如何去进行业务操作,保证后续的用户验收人员依据已编写的用例就可以顺利执行。
4.测试结果的可判定性
用户验收用例的测试执行结果的正确性是可判定的,每一个用户验收用例都应有明确的期望结果,保证用户验收人员可以依据具体的检查点,去核对业务需求实现的正确性和有效性。
5.测试结果的可再现性
针对相同的用户验收用例,采用同类型的业务数据,系统的执行结果应当是相同的。
6.用例的可复用性
设计用户验收用例时,要保证业务需求功能粒度划分合理、设计方法专业、编写内容规范,对后续的用户验收或者用户培训工作起到借鉴作用。
用户验收用例设计原则
发表于:2018-07-10
作者:刘唐
来源:网络转载
 相关文章
软件测试技术之测试用例场景法的3个例子 全栈代码测试覆盖率及用例发现系统的... 测试用例设计方法有哪些? 测试用例知识扫盲:你真的懂了什么是... 成为测试开发工程师后,我如何看待并... 测试流程 - 关于用例评审,给你的 9 点建议- 周排行
- 月排行
-   软件测试技术之测试用例场景法的3个例子
-   视频播放测试用例
-   测试用例之支付功能测试点整理
-   阿里巴巴B2B测试用例编写规范
-   如果让你来测试扫码支付,你会考虑哪...
-   七分钟教会你如何编写一个合格的测试用例
-   我所理解的测试策略——功能用例设计策略
-   测试用例之支付功能测试点整理
-   相机测试用例:手机、相机和摄像头测...
-   软件测试技术之测试用例场景法的3个例子
-   浅谈测试用例分级
-   嵌入式软件测试方法、案例与模板详解...
-   史上最详细的测试用例设计方法讲解
-   系统测试用例设计思路/模型